Setting SMART Goals for Marketing Objectives

Setting SMART goals-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ound-is critical for guiding digital marketing efforts. These goals provide clarity and a framework for evaluating success.

For example, instead of stating a goal to “increase website traffic,” a SMART goal would specify “increase website traffic by 25% within six months.” This clear target enables the marketing team to devise strategies, allocate resources effectively, and assess outcomes based on data-driven results.

Search Engine Optimisation for Organic Reach

Search Engine Optimisation (SEO) plays a crucial role in increasing organic visibility. A robust SEO strategy involves targeting long-tail keywords that capture specific audience intent. Many businesses may wonder ‘what is a long-tail keyword?’ and why it matters. Unlike short, generic keywords, long-tail keywords are longer, more specific phrases that users type into search engines when looking for particular information. These keywords tend to have lower competition and higher conversion rates because they attract users who already have a clear intent, whether it’s making a purchase, finding a service, or seeking detailed answers.

Optimising on-page elements, such as title tags, meta descriptions, and header tags, can significantly impact search rankings.

Incorporating local SEO strategies, especially when paired with the expertise of a reputable local SEO agency to fine-tune your approach and target location-specific audiences effectively, helps businesses appear in relevant local searches, which is vital for regionally focused companies. Additionally, ensuring the website is mobile-friendly and has fast load times contributes to a better user experience and higher rankings.

Pay-Per-Click and Search Engine Marketing

Pay-per-click (PPC) advertising and Search Engine Marketing (SEM) are effective for immediate traffic. These tactics allow targeting specific demographics and keywords to maximise visibility.

Using well-crafted ad copy and including strong calls to action can improve click-through rates. Regularly testing and optimising ad campaigns is essential for managing costs and increasing conversions.

Utilising remarketing strategies can re-engage users who previously interacted with the business, enhancing potential conversion rates. Tracking metrics such as return on investment (ROI) and cost per acquisition (CPA) is vital to evaluate the effectiveness of PPC campaigns.

Monitoring With Data Analytics and Google Analytics

Monitoring website performance through data analytics is vital for informed decision-making. Google Analytics provides comprehensive insights into user behaviour, traffic sources, and conversion rates.

Setting up conversion tracking is essential for assessing the effectiveness of marketing strategies. Businesses should focus on key performance indicators (KPIs), such as bounce rate and average session duration, to identify areas for improvement.

Regularly analysing these metrics allows businesses to adjust tactics and optimise user engagement. By understanding which channels drive the most traffic and conversions, companies can allocate resources effectively and refine their marketing goals.
